Understanding the factors that contribute to urinary flow issues is crucial. Benign prostatic hyperplasia (BPH) is common in older men, leading to an enlarged prostate that may constrict the urethra and impede the flow of urine. Symptoms often include frequent urination, urgency, weak stream, and nighttime trips to the bathroom, disrupting quality of life. Women can also face urinary challenges, especially post-menopause, when hormonal changes can weaken bladder control.

One of the most popular ingredients found in prostate support supplements is saw palmetto. This herb is derived from the berries of the saw palmetto plant and has been shown to help reduce symptoms associated with BPH, such as increased urinary flow and reduced nighttime urination, allowing for a better night’s sleep.
Another beneficial ingredient is pygeum africanum, an extract from the bark of the African plum tree. Studies have indicated that pygeum can alleviate urinary symptoms linked to BPH by decreasing inflammation and promoting healthier urinary function. In particular, it may enhance urinary flow and reduce discomfort, helping individuals regain control over their urinary habits.
Pumpkin seed oil is yet another supplement component that can contribute to improved urinary health. Rich in zinc and essential fatty acids, pumpkin seed oil has been traditionally used to support prostate function and improve urinary flow. It’s believed to strengthen the bladder and improve overall organ health while also alleviating symptoms of an overactive bladder, which many individuals experience.
In addition to these key ingredients, other natural compounds like nettle root, horsetail, and beta-sitosterol continue to show promise in supporting urinary health. Nettle root may work synergistically with saw palmetto to enhance effects on urinary flow, while horsetail is known for its diuretic properties, promoting kidney and bladder health.
